Skip to main content
Back to Jobs

Director, MDR (Managed Detection and Response)

Lead MDR strategy to strengthen cyber resilience for global clients

As Director of MDR at Barracuda Networks, you will lead the strategy and execution of Managed Detection and Response services to protect clients against complex cyber threats. You will work with a global team to enhance cyber resilience through innovative XDR and security solutions. Your role involves overseeing delivery of managed security services that safeguard email, data, applications, and networks for IT professionals and MSPs worldwide.

Why This Role?

Work with a leading cybersecurity company trusted by hundreds of thousands of IT professionals globally

Key Responsibilities

  • Lead the strategy and vision for Managed Detection and Response services
  • Oversee delivery of managed XDR and security solutions to protect client environments
  • Strengthen cyber resilience by protecting email, data, applications, and networks
  • Collaborate with global teams to innovate and improve threat protection offerings
  • Ensure solutions are easy to buy, deploy, and use for IT professionals and MSPs
  • Drive execution of MDR services to meet the needs of a worldwide customer base

Requirements

  • Experience leading cybersecurity or managed security services teams
  • Background in threat detection, incident response, or XDR technologies
  • Understanding of email, data, application, and network security principles
  • Experience working with IT professionals and managed service providers
  • Ability to drive strategy and innovation in cyber resilience solutions
  • Familiarity with global delivery of security services to diverse markets

Required Skills

cybersecurityxdrmanaged detection and responsethreat intelligenceincident responseMDR strategycybersecurity leadershipthreat detectionglobal team management

Keywords

Director MDRManaged Detection and Responsecybersecurity leadershipXDR strategyglobal security servicesBarracuda Networks
View Original Description from Adzuna

Original description from Adzuna

Come join our passionate team! Barracuda is a leading cybersecurity company providing complete protection against complex threats. Our platform protects email, data, applications, and networks with innovative solutions, and a managed XDR service, to strengthen cyber resilience. Hundreds of thousands of IT professionals and managed service providers worldwide trust us to protect and support them with solutions that are easy to buy, deploy, and use. We know a diverse workforce adds to our collect…

Apply free

Free account · no credit card · Log in

Pro Rp39k/mo · unlimited applies + AI resume

View 5 similar jobs →

Open to Indonesia
Source
Adzuna
Job Type
full time
Location
Worldwide Remote · Remote
Category
Engineering
Seniority
lead
Posted
May 30, 2026

Share this job

Help a friend find their next remote role.

Apply free

Free account · no credit card · Log in

Pro Rp39k/mo · unlimited applies + AI resume